Foxface Rabbitfish

Foxface RabbitfishFoxface Rabbitfish Cartoon
Quantity: 1
Diet: Garlic Soaked Nori, Mysis Shrimp, Algae Flakes
Favorite spot: right half of tank (except before or during feeding)

The Foxface Rabbitfish is a unique fish having venomous spines along its dorsal and ventral sides, extending them when stressed or thretened along with discoloring.

Percula Clownfish

Percula ClownfishPercula Clownfish Cartoon
Quantity: 2
Diet: Mysis Shrimp, Algae Flakes
Favorite spot: far right end of tank

Made popular by the movie Finding Nemo, the Percula Clownfish is probably the most recognizable of saltwater fish. Many people think that these triple white striped, orange fish need anemones to survive, but some clowns will not even host in these flower-like polyps.

Green Chromis

Green ChromisGreen Chromis Cartoon
Quantity: 1
Diet: Mysis Shrimp, Algae Flakes
Favorite spot: small caverns in rocks, anywhere in tank

While appearing inappropriately named due to their light blue color, these slightly shy fish do look somewhat green when viewed from above.

Kole Tang

Kole Tang
Quantity: 1
Diet: Garlic Soaked Nori, Mysis Shrimp, Algae Flakes
Favorite spot: anywhere in tank

The Kole Tang is a brownish fish with many lines running fron head to tail. Often swimming through the large caverns of the rocks, it frequently bites the rock and glass attempting to get a snack of algae.
